This mercury switch, also known as a contactless mercury switch or a mercury tilt switch, offers a unique and reliable switching mechanism that is capable of sensing the tilt or orientation of an object.

The switch comprises a hollow glass bulb filled with mercury. When the bulb is in an upright position, the mercury forms a connection between two metal contacts inside, thus completing the electrical circuit. However, when the bulb is tipped or tilted to an angle, the mercury shifts, breaking the connection and opening the circuit.
